1. Account Creation
Visit LinkedIn's Website:
- Go to LinkedIn.
Sign Up:
- Click on the "Join now" button.
- Enter your first name, last name, email address, and create a password.
- Click "Agree & Join."
Profile Setup:
- Follow the prompts to add your location, job title, company, and industry.
- Add a profile photo and a background image to make your profile stand out.

3. Post Creation
Text Post
- Create a Post:
- Click on the "Start a post" field at the top of your homepage.
- Type your message in the text box.
- Click "Post."
Image Post
- Create a Post:
- Click on the "Start a post" field.
- Click the "Image" icon.
- Select an image from your device.
- Add text if desired.
- Click "Post."
Video Post
- Create a Post:
- Click on the "Start a post" field.
- Click the "Video" icon.
- Select a video from your device.
- Add a description.
- Click "Post."
Audio Post
- Create a Post:
- LinkedIn does not have a direct feature for audio posts.
- You can upload an audio file to a third-party platform (like SoundCloud) and share the link in a text post.
Location Post
- Create a Post:
- Click on the "Start a post" field.
- Click the "Location" icon.
- Select your location.
- Add text if desired.
- Click "Post."
4. Page Creation
Access LinkedIn Pages:
- Click on the "Work" icon in the top right corner of your LinkedIn homepage.
- Click "Create a Company Page."
Set Up Your Page:
- Choose the type of page you want to create (Company, Showcase, Educational Institution).
- Enter your page identity details (Name, URL).
- Add company details (Industry, Size, Type).
- Click "Create Page."
Customize Your Page:
- Add a logo and cover image.
- Fill in the "About" section with your company description.
- Add contact details and location.
5. Use Full Settings
Access Settings:
- Click on your profile icon in the top right corner.
- Select "Settings & Privacy."
Profile Settings:
- Edit your public profile settings.
- Manage who can see your email address.
- Customize your profile visibility.
Account Settings:
- Change your email addresses.
- Manage your sign-in security.
- Adjust ad preferences.
